Manufacturer Description

Baader's New VariLock T-2 Extension Tubes give you complete adjustability to enable you to exactly set or vary the spacing between T-2 components. Perfect for exact positioning of reducers, coma correctors, and other optical or imaging system components.

The VariLock extension tubes feature an accurately engraved graduated scale for an easy visual determination of the tube length (0.5mm graduations). Simply rotate the inner tube until the desired length is reached, then tighten the lockring with the included spanner wrench.

Full internal threading and blackening kills any stray light reflections. 2" OD enables use in any 2" system.

As an added bonus, the external T-threaded portion can be removed and replaced with a dovetail ring (included) that inserts into standard camera T-rings (not included), for use with DSLRs.

      I use this to take up the backfocus in one of my imaging setups (an f/4 imaging newt and a DSLR camera), where I use the Baader Rowe coma corrector. I don't use an off-axis guider, so I needed this to take up the backfocus that the OAG otherwise would. Works like a charm, and my field is flat and coma-free.
